Job Description

As part of our ongoing commitment to organisational sustainability and knowledge sharing, we are commissioning a freelance professional to document the complete process of producing the ABTT Theatre Show and develop a comprehensive Event Delivery Manual.

Working closely with the Event Director, this freelance role will involve observing, recording, and documenting the planning, production, and delivery process of the ABTT Theatre Show (http://www.abtt.org.uk/abtt-theatre-show/ – www.abtt.org.uk/abtt-theatre-show/).

The goal is to create a practical and user-friendly Event Planning & Delivery Manual which can be used by staff if the lead event planner is unavailable.

The document will clearly outline:

  • What tasks need to be done
  • When and how they should be done
  • Who is involved at each stage
  • Contact information for key contractors and suppliers
  • Schedules, templates, timelines, and deadlines
  • Practical notes and lessons learned

This manual will serve as an essential reference document for future team members, support succession planning, and ensure continuity and efficiency in delivering future editions of the ABTT Theatre Show.
